Hi,

I'm new to GCP (just created the account few hours ago). I need to change my organization name from the default NoOrganization to something else.
I've tried from admin.google.com but each time I try to login I receive "admin.google.com is for G Suite accounts only. Regular Gmail accounts cannot be used to sign in to admin.google.com. Learn more". The e-mail address used to login doesn't end in @gmail.com :-)

Any tips on how I can change the organization name?

Since you don’t have a G-Suite account you might need to sign-up Cloud Identity services in-order to create an Organization resource. Once you signed up, you can set-up your own organization by following this documentation. Please note that to be able to change your organization name you will need to buy a domain name, as this is required by Cloud Identity.
